11 class Filter(Parameter, dict):
13 A type of parameter that represents a filter on one or more
14 columns of a database table. fields should be a dictionary of
15 field names and types, e.g.
17 {'node_id': Parameter(int, "Node identifier"),
18 'hostname': Parameter(int, "Fully qualified hostname", max = 255),
21 Only filters on non-sequence type fields are supported.
23 filter should be a dictionary of field names and values
24 representing an intersection (if join_with is AND) or union (if
25 join_with is OR) filter. If a value is a sequence type, then it
26 should represent a list of possible values for that field.
